业务需求

在我们的日常需求中,会有这种

数据表中存在图片字段,为必填,需要在操作过程中做到

  • 创建数据时,图片字段必须
  • 修改数据时,图片字段如果不传,就不修改

解决方案

业务数据操作

如果要保持原来的图片数据,那只要修改的时候带着原来的参数即可

  1. 加载表单时带原来的数据
  2. 图片数据放在隐藏的文本域中
  3. 提交表单时如果图片上传的字段没有值,就将原来的图片数据从隐藏文本域中拿出来

这样的操作当然能满足需求,但是太复杂了

定义场景setScenario

在Yii的数据操作中,一般的逻辑如下

  1. 判断是否有提交数据Yii::$app->request->post()
  2. 表单数据加载到模型model中 $model->load(Yii::$app->request->post())
  3. 保存model的数据 $model->save()

重点时第三步,在save的操作中,默认执行验证操作,判断提交的数据是否如何model中的规则

其中 关于场景的部分,通过on定义场景

'on' => ['scenario1', 'scenario2'],

可以应用规则。 如果未设置此选项,则该规则将适用于所有场景。

rule can be applied. If this option is not set, the rule will apply to all scenarios.

当规则对应的场景时,规则会被采用

  ['password', 'compare', 'compareAttribute' => 'password2', 'on' => 'register'],
['password', 'authenticate', 'on' => 'login'],

那么,最后我们得到关于图片的字段约束规则如下

            [['images'], 'required', 'on' => ['create'],'enableClientValidation'=>false],
[['images'], 'defaultHead', 'skipOnEmpty' => false, 'on' => ['edit']],
